Clark,
I found Flitz about 30 years ago when I was a gun dealer. It is made in Germany and we used it to polish blued and stainless guns. Bluing is very thin and an abrasive cleaner will take it off of a gun in a heartbeat. Flitz will not take bluing off and leaves a high polish shine that also leaves a metal protection that lasts for months. That said I use it on metal, paint, plastic with great success. You don't have to use it in small areas. I apply it with one of those polishing balls on a cordless drill on my wheels. Works great. Really is worth a try. Jim
.
Thanks Jim...I have had my flitz since about 1990. It does do an excellent job on removing stains in aluminum, cleaning, etc. I swear you will like the California stuff the first time you use it on bare aluminum.
